Gong Suhe blinked. She didn't know herself. Was she seeing things?
In front of her, Di Xingchen's eyes seemed to be hiding something, causing her to not dare to pry.
But in the next second, the clouds in his eyes suddenly disappeared. There was nothing left.
Just now, it seemed to be an illusion.
"I picked a hemostatic grass."
Gong Suhe took the initiative to speak, "Are you making a wish?"
Zhai Xingchen nodded.
"Wow, what wish did you make?"
After Gong Suhe said that, she hurriedly waved her hand. "I was just casually asking. Don't say it out loud. If you say it out loud, it won't work."
Zhai Xingchen continued to nod his head.
When Gong Suhe saw him like this, she could not help but comfort him. "Don't worry. Your sincere wish will definitely come true!"
However, after hearing such a simple sentence, the light in Di Xingchen's eyes wavered, "You say, you will come true?"
Gong Suhe did not understand why he would be like this, but she still nodded seriously. "Yes, I and the deities in the sky hope that it is true."
"Okay."
Zhai Xingchen looked at her and suddenly smiled.
This was the first time Gong Suhe saw him smile. He smiled until his neat and white teeth were revealed. He smiled so brightly that his eyes were shining. His beautiful facial features seemed to be dyed with a bright and beautiful color. He was very beautiful.
Gong Suhe still remembered the first time she saw Zhai Xingchen. Lin Qi described him as the vampire prince in the castle.
But now, when he smiled, he no longer looked like a vampire prince. He looked like a young man who had walked out of a comic book.
Clean and pure.
"Zhai Xingchen, you look good when you smile. You can smile more in the future."
Gong Suhe thought that college was still better. Her classmates were more friendly. No one should bully Zhai Xingchen anymore.
She hoped that he would be fine, just like the other boys who were not too healthy. Even if he was in the deep abyss, he would still be able to surface and bathe in the sunlight.
The two of them drank some water and continued forward.
Sunlight fell from the leaves and their bodies were covered in mottled shadows.
There were a few areas where the road was a little narrow. Gong Suhe walked behind Zhai Xingchen and helped him push the wheelchair.
Zhai Xingchen looked at the road ahead and secretly hoped that it would never end.
However, he hoped that his wish just now would come true.
He told the Ancestral Buddha that he hoped that his legs would be fine. He would be able to stand by her side and accompany her for the rest of her life.
Zhai Xingchen took a look at the map. They were getting closer and closer to their destination.
He was unwilling to part with them, but he could not find a reason to stay.
Until Gong Suhe's words suddenly resounded in his mind. She said that she had found a medicine to stop bleeding.2
So, he could... just stay there. Just as the two of them were about to walk through that narrow path, Zhai Xingchen's hand was suddenly cut by a thorn at the side.
He let out a soft hiss and raised his hand. He discovered that there was an additional wound on the palm of his left hand. Fresh blood flowed out from the wound.
Gong Suhe, who was standing at the side, stopped when she saw it. "Why did you cut it?"
She quickly lifted Zhai Xingchen's hand and saw that the wound was smooth and clean without any dirt. So she quickly took out a tissue and pressed it down for him. She said, "I will use the herbs to stop the bleeding. You press it first. It will be done very soon."
Zhai Xingchen did not feel pain. Instead, when he saw Gong Suhe's nervous look, he felt warm in his heart and actually wanted to smile instinctively.
But he tried his best to hold it in.
Gong Suhe used the mineral water that she carried with her to wash the herbs. Then, she quickly fiddled with them before grabbing Zhai Xingchen's hand.
She took the tissue away and gently covered the wound with the herbal medicine.
